Detailed crafting and unique finds within talismania online provide lasting value

The digital landscape is brimming with immersive online experiences, and among the most captivating is that of talismania online. It’s a world where intricate crafting systems meet the thrill of discovering rare and valuable items, offering players a unique and enduring sense of progression. The game isn’t just about completing quests or leveling up; it’s about building, creating, and unearthing treasures that hold genuine worth within the game's economy and beyond. This focus on player-driven value is a core tenet of its design, setting it apart from many other massively multiplayer online role-playing games (MMORPGs).

Unlike games that rely heavily on repetitive grinding or pay-to-win mechanics, talismania prioritizes a rewarding cycle of effort and discovery. The depth of the crafting system allows players to specialize in various professions, producing items that are always in demand. This creates a dynamic marketplace where skilled artisans can thrive, and collectors can seek out truly exceptional pieces. Furthermore, the game’s unique find system ensures that even casual exploration can yield surprising and delightful results, keeping players engaged and motivated to delve deeper into its expansive world. The emphasis is on investment – time, skill, and effort – yielding tangible and lasting benefits, which is a powerful draw for dedicated gamers.

The Art of Crafting: A Skill-Based Economy

The crafting system in talismania is far more complex than simply combining materials. It’s a multifaceted skill system that demands dedication, experimentation, and a keen understanding of resource management. Players aren’t just making items; they’re building reputations as master artisans. Different professions, such as blacksmithing, tailoring, alchemy, and enchanting, each offer unique opportunities and challenges. Blacksmiths, for example, can forge powerful weapons and armor, while tailors create stylish and functional clothing. Alchemists brew potent potions and elixirs, and enchanters imbue items with magical properties. Mastering a profession requires not only acquiring the necessary skills but also gathering rare and high-quality materials.

Resource Gathering and Management

Effective resource gathering is pivotal for any aspiring crafter. The game world is filled with various nodes and locations where players can harvest raw materials. These resources range from common ores and herbs to rare gems and exotic animal hides. Success relies on utilizing the most appropriate tools, understanding the optimal harvesting times, and sometimes even competing with other players for limited resources. Furthermore, careful resource management is crucial. Players need to balance their immediate crafting needs with the potential for long-term investments. Storing and protecting valuable resources from theft or decay is also an important aspect of the crafting experience, adding another layer of complexity and strategic depth.

Profession
Primary Resources
Key Skills
Typical Products
Blacksmithing Ores, Coal, Gems Forging, Tempering, Refining Weapons, Armor, Tools
Tailoring Fibers, Cloth, Dyes Sewing, Weaving, Patternmaking Clothing, Bags, Accessories
Alchemy Herbs, Reagents, Essences Brewing, Distillation, Mixing Potions, Elixirs, Poisons
Enchanting Runes, Crystals, Magical Components Imbuing, Scribing, Artification Enchanted Weapons and Armor

The interplay between these crafting professions creates a vibrant and interdependent economy. Blacksmiths rely on miners to provide ores, tailors require farmers to cultivate cotton, and alchemists need herbalists to gather rare plants. This interconnectedness fosters collaboration and trade, making the crafting system a dynamic and engaging aspect of the game.

The Thrill of the Find: Unique Item Discovery

Beyond the crafting system, a significant draw of talismania is the opportunity to discover unique and powerful items. These aren’t your typical procedurally generated loot drops; they’re meticulously designed artifacts with compelling backstories and exceptional properties. Discovering a truly remarkable item can be a game-changing experience, providing players with a significant advantage in combat, crafting, or exploration. The game cleverly encourages exploration, rewarding players who venture off the beaten path and investigate hidden locations. These discoveries often require solving puzzles, overcoming challenges, or simply being in the right place at the right time.

Methods of Item Acquisition

Unique items can be acquired through a variety of methods. Dungeon exploration is a primary source, with challenging encounters and cunningly hidden treasures awaiting those who dare to delve into the depths. World events, such as limited-time quests or special monster spawns, also offer opportunities to obtain rare items. However, perhaps the most rewarding method is through dedicated exploration. Hidden chests, secret passages, and forgotten ruins are scattered throughout the game world, each potentially containing a treasure of untold value. The game also features a robust trading system, allowing players to buy, sell, and barter for unique items with one another, fostering a thriving community marketplace.

  • Dungeon Exploration: Challenging encounters and hidden treasures.
  • World Events: Limited-time quests and special monster spawns.
  • Exploration: Hidden chests, secret passages, and forgotten ruins.
  • Trading: Player-driven marketplace for buying and selling unique items.
  • Quest Rewards: Completion of complex and challenging quests.

The rarity and desirability of these unique items contribute significantly to the game’s economy. Players are willing to invest considerable time and resources to acquire them, creating a vibrant trading ecosystem and fostering a sense of competition and accomplishment.

The Importance of Player Specialization

Talismania isn’t a game that rewards jack-of-all-trades; instead, it strongly incentivizes players to specialize in one or two areas of expertise. Whether it’s mastering a specific crafting profession, becoming a skilled explorer, or excelling in combat, focusing your efforts yields significantly greater rewards. This specialization fosters a sense of community, as players rely on each other’s expertise to achieve common goals. A blacksmith might need a tailor to create protective clothing for working in a hot forge, while an explorer might hire a guide to navigate treacherous terrain. This interdependence creates a dynamic and engaging social environment.

Synergies and Collaboration

The game’s design actively encourages collaboration between players with different specializations. For example, a group of adventurers might consist of a tank, a healer, and a damage dealer, each relying on the others to succeed. Similarly, a crafting guild might be composed of blacksmiths, tailors, and alchemists, working together to produce high-quality items and fulfill lucrative contracts. This collaborative aspect is central to the talismania experience, fostering a sense of camaraderie and shared accomplishment. Players learn to appreciate the unique skills and contributions of others, creating a cohesive and supportive community.

  1. Identify your preferred playstyle: Combat, Crafting, Exploration.
  2. Focus your skill development: Invest points in relevant skills.
  3. Gather specialized resources: Acquire materials specific to your craft.
  4. Collaborate with other players: Trade, share knowledge, and assist each other.
  5. Seek out challenging content: Push your limits and test your skills.

This emphasis on specialization also contributes to the game’s economic stability. With a diverse range of skills and professions, the demand for specialized goods and services remains consistently high, ensuring that players can always find opportunities to earn a living and progress their characters.

The Dynamic Economy of Talismania

Unlike many MMORPGs where the economy is heavily controlled by the developers, talismania features a largely player-driven economy. The prices of goods and services are determined by supply and demand, creating a dynamic and ever-changing marketplace. Skilled crafters can capitalize on shortages to sell their goods at a premium, while savvy traders can profit from arbitrage opportunities. This economic freedom empowers players to take control of their financial destiny and build thriving businesses.
